He was Israel's most valuable spy inside Hamas – and certainly the most unlikely. For more than a decade, Mosab Hassan Yousef disrupted dozens of suicide bombings and assassination attempts by the militant group, saving hundreds of lives. Failed attempt to kill Israeli envoy in Jordan – Jerusalem Post
A bomb exploded near a two-car convoy belonging to Israel’s embassy in Jordan on Thursday afternoon. The cars were making their way to Amman. No one was hurt in the incident and the vehicles continued to their destination shortly thereafter. The Foreign Ministry received a briefing on the incident.
